Lee Earl Rogers, 72

Services for Lee Earl Rogers were held January 14 at Grissom Funeral Home with burial in the Haven Hill Cemetery.

Lee Earl Rogers, age 72, died Sunday, January 12 at NHC in Dickson, Tennessee. A native of Adair County, he was a son of the late U.L. and Ada Finn Rogers, and he was a retired crane operator.

Survivors include: a daughter and son-in-law, Joan and Bill McFall of Kingston Springs, Tennessee; one son and daughter-in-law, Ronald and Tamara Rogers of Camden, Tennessee; two brothers, Haskel Rogers of Gradyville and Cecil Rogers of Campbellsville; two sisters, Hallie Scott of Cookeville, Tennessee, and Elva Gabehart of Columbia. Also surviving are two grandsons, Shaun McFall and Brandon Rogers and one great granddaughter, Allie Rogers, plus several nieces and nephews.

Rev Richard Lowe officiated at the ceremony at Grissom Funeral Home in Columbia. Casket bearers were: Kenneth Scott, Joe Rogers, Benny Grant, Ernie Rogers, Jeff Johnson and Brandon Rogers.
